Arrowleaf Balsamroot from Utah. Balsamorhiza sagittata, commonly called arrowleaf balsamroot is a striking perennial native to the western United States, where it dominates sagebrush steppe, foothills, and open mountain slopes. Recognizable by its large, arrow-shaped leaves and brilliant yellow, sunflower-like blooms, this long-lived plant is an early-season powerhouse for native pollinators, offering pollen and nectar when few other flowers are in bloom. Arrowleaf balsamroot plays an important ecological role by stabilizing soils with its deep taproot, supporting native bees, butterflies, and birds, and contributing to resilient western grassland ecosystems. Well adapted to dry conditions and poor soils, it is an excellent choice for native plant gardens, restoration projects, and landscapes focused on long-term ecological health.
